RHB launches Malaysia’s first bank-owned payment gateway
The platform routes online collections straight into RHB accounts with automated reconciliation.
RHB Banking Group has launched RHB PAY, Malaysia's first bank-owned unified online payment gateway, designed to let businesses collect digital payments directly into their RHB accounts.
The internally built platform combines bank-grade security, automated reconciliation, and faster fund settlement for mid-sized enterprises, corporates, and government-linked institutions.
The rollout comes as digital transactions in Malaysia reached 18.4 billion in 2025, up 25% from 14.7 billion in 2024, according to Bank Negara Malaysia data.
At launch, the service integrates card payments, FPX, and DuitNow Pay via PayNet's national infrastructure.
A second phase, scheduled for the fourth quarter of 2026, will introduce e-wallets, QR payments, Direct Debit, and Auto Debit options.
